/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Beyond the Spin Mastering Digital Casino Games with vincispin and Proven Strategies for Winning.

Beyond the Spin Mastering Digital Casino Games with vincispin and Proven Strategies for Winning.

Beyond the Spin: Mastering Digital Casino Games with vincispin and Proven Strategies for Winning.

Navigating the world of digital casinos can be both exhilarating and daunting. With a vast array of games, strategies, and platforms available, players often seek tools and insights to enhance their experience and improve their chances of winning. This is where vincispin comes into play – a system designed to offer players a structured approach to understanding and mastering these games. It's not about guaranteed wins, but about informed decision-making and a deeper understanding of the mechanics that drive digital casino success. This guide will explore how to leverage such systems and implement proven strategies to play smarter and potentially more profitably in the digital casino landscape.

Understanding the Fundamentals of Digital Casino Games

Before diving into specific strategies, it’s essential to grasp the underlying principles governing digital casino games. Most games rely on Random Number Generators (RNGs) to ensure fairness and unpredictability. Understanding how RNGs work is crucial, as it dispels the myth of “hot streaks” or patterns. Each spin, roll, or deal is an independent event, unaffected by previous outcomes. Therefore, relying on intuition or gut feelings can be misleading. The house edge, inherent in every casino game, represents the statistical advantage the casino holds over the player in the long run.

Furthermore, different games possess varying levels of volatility. High volatility games offer larger payouts but less frequently, while low volatility games provide smaller, more consistent wins. Recognizing your risk tolerance is critical when selecting which games to play. A skillful approach involves selecting games that align with your budgetary and risk preferences.

Game Type
House Edge (Approximate)
Volatility
Blackjack (Optimal Strategy) 0.5% - 1% Low to Medium
Roulette (European) 2.7% Medium
Slots 2% - 15% Low to High (varies widely)
Baccarat 1.06% (Banker Bet) Low

The Role of vincispin in Strategy Development

vincispin isn't a magical formula, but rather a framework for analyzing and optimizing your gameplay. It emphasizes the importance of data tracking, pattern recognition, and informed decision-making. The system often involves meticulous record-keeping of your wins, losses, and betting patterns. This data can reveal valuable insights into your strengths, weaknesses, and areas for improvement. For example, understanding which betting strategies perform better for your chosen games.

A core component often includes understanding probability and expected value. By calculating the long-term return of different bets, you can identify those with the highest potential for profit. vincispin encourages players to move beyond simply relying on luck. It's about making calculated decisions based on a solid understanding of the game’s rules and the principles of probability. It's about turning a game of chance into a more strategic pursuit.

Effective Bankroll Management

One of the most critical aspects of successful casino play, and frequently emphasized within a vincispin approach, is meticulous bankroll management. This involves setting a predetermined budget for your gaming activities and sticking to it religiously. A common rule of thumb is to allocate only a small percentage of your disposable income to casino gaming. It is common practice not to lose more than you can comfortably afford. Furthermore, dividing your bankroll into smaller units allows you to weather losing streaks without depleting your funds too quickly. This prevents emotional decision-making, which is a common pitfall for many players.

Establishing clear win and loss limits is equally essential. When you reach your predetermined win limit, take your profits and step away from the table. Similarly, if you reach your loss limit, stop playing and avoid chasing your losses. Chasing losses is a surefire way to escalate your losses and jeopardize your bankroll. Disciplined bankroll management is the foundation of a sustainable and enjoyable gaming experience.

Leveraging Bonuses and Promotions

Digital casinos frequently offer bonuses and promotions to attract new players and retain existing ones. These offers can range from welcome bonuses to deposit matches, free spins, and loyalty programs. However, it’s crucial to carefully read the terms and conditions associated with these bonuses. Many bonuses come with wagering requirements, which specify the amount you must wager before you can withdraw your winnings.

The wagering requirements can significantly impact the value of a bonus. A high wagering requirement may make it difficult to actually cash out your winnings. Understanding these requirements and choosing bonuses with favorable terms is a key component of any effective casino strategy. Often, a vincispin approach would involve calculating the actual expected value of a bonus, considering the wagering requirements and other restrictions.

  • Welcome Bonuses: Typically offered to new players upon registration.
  • Deposit Matches: The casino matches a percentage of your deposit.
  • Free Spins: Allow you to spin the reels of a slot game for free.
  • Loyalty Programs: Reward players for their continued patronage.

Advanced Strategies for Specific Games

Different casino games require different strategies. For instance, blackjack, with its element of skill, benefits from learning basic strategy charts, which outline the optimal play for every possible hand combination. This strategy minimizes the house edge and maximizes your chances of winning. For games like roulette, understanding the different betting options and their associated odds is crucial. The 'Martingale' strategy, where you double your bet after each loss, is a popular approach, but it carries significant risk as it can quickly deplete your bankroll.

For slot games, understanding the paytable, the volatility, and the Return to Player (RTP) percentage is important. While slots are primarily games of chance, choosing machines with higher RTP percentages can improve your long-term odds. Applying a strategic approach to slot play means managing your bet size and avoiding chasing losses. Successful play with vincispin requires informed gameplay and adapting your strategy, considering the risks and the rewards.

  1. Blackjack: Learn and consistently apply basic strategy.
  2. Roulette: Understand the odds of each bet and manage your bankroll carefully.
  3. Slots: Choose games with higher RTP percentages and set a budget.
  4. Poker: Study game theory and practice optimal play.

Ultimately, success in the digital casino world isn't about tricking the system or finding a guaranteed winning strategy. It’s about approaching the games with a disciplined mindset, a solid understanding of the underlying principles, and a commitment to responsible gaming.